Job Description

Data Scientist with a Computer Science background. The individual will be a part of a team working on a modular high-throughput data processing framework for biological imaging, interfacing imaging hardware on one end, and delivering visual, actionable insights to scientists on the other.

1. Presenting scientific imaging data to scientific audiences in an academic or industrial, R&D engineering setting. Business intelligence experience does not qualify 2. High speed, low latency, real-time synchronization of data streams and devices. 3. Building graphical, dynamic scientific visualizations using databases. 4. Artificial Intelligence as it relates to image processing. 5. Robust software design principles. Required Skills and Qualifications: BS/MS + work experience OR a recent PhD. Programming skills: python, R General Database skills: SQL or NoSQL (e.g. MongoDb) Knowledge of Math and Statistics. Machine Learning: basic to advanced as it applies to image processing. Data visualization tools: plotly, D3, matplotlib Communication skills: Presenting data to scientific audiences, incorporating scientists in the software design. Solid SWE background: Algorithms and data structures, OOP design patterns, algorithm complexity, understanding of how the computational backends work. SOLID principle understanding. Familiarity with operating systems, virtual environments and multithreading Hadoop, MapR, Apache Storm, TorchServe and related.
